Biography
Ana A. Alpízar (La Habana, 1990) graduated as film and TV director from University of Arts (Universidad de las Artes). She has written, edited and/or directed several short films presented at international festivals such as NEFIAC, Havana Film Festival, Gibara, SGAE en Corto, Almacén de la Imagen and Young Filmmakers Showcase. In 2014, he was selected to participate in Talents Guadalajara. Her short film HAPI BERDEY YUSIMI IN YUR DEY (2020) was selected at Fribourg IFF 2020.
